How should enterprises educate and train their employees about safety in production?
The Law on Safety in Production stipulates: \x0d\ Article 25 The production and business operation entity shall educate and train the employees in safety in production, so as to ensure that the employees have the necessary knowledge of safety in production, be familiar with the rules and regulations related to safety in production, master the safety operation skills of their posts, understand the emergency measures for accidents and know their rights and obligations in safety in production. \x0d\ Employees who have not passed the safety education and training are not allowed to work at their posts. \x0d\ Where a production and business operation entity uses labor dispatch personnel, it shall bring the labor dispatch personnel into the unified management of its employees, and educate and train the labor dispatch personnel in post safety operation procedures and safety operation skills. \x0d\ The labor dispatch unit shall provide necessary safety education and training to the dispatched workers. \x0d\ Where the production and business operation entity accepts the internship of students from secondary vocational schools or institutions of higher learning, it shall provide corresponding safety education and training for the interns and provide necessary labor protection articles. \x0d\ The school shall assist the production and business operation entities to educate and train interns in production safety. \x0d\ The production and business operation entity shall establish a safety production education and training file, and truthfully record the time, content, participants and assessment results of safety production education and training. \x0d\ Article 26 When adopting new technologies, new processes, new materials or new equipment, production and business operation entities must understand and master their safety technical characteristics, take effective safety protection measures, and conduct special safety education and training for employees. \x0d\ Article 27 Special operators of production and business operation entities must receive special safety operation training in accordance with relevant state regulations and obtain corresponding qualifications before taking up their posts. \x0d\ The scope of special operators shall be determined by the safety production supervision and management department of the State Council in conjunction with relevant departments of the State Council.
